Abstract

A lens for use with a light emitting source is provided. The lens has a main body with a light-collecting face and a light-emitting face and which defines an optical axis extending through the centers of these two faces. A pocket for receiving light from the light source is defined in the light-collecting face by an inner axially-facing surface surrounded by an inner radially-facing surface. The inner axially-facing surface is concave and has a spherical shape. The inner radially-facing surface has a non-spherical, tapered shape and extends between the axially-facing surface and an open end of the pocket. A light assembly incorporating the lens includes a light-emitting diode.

Claims (31)

1. A lens for use with a light emitting source, the lens comprising:

a main body having a light-collecting face and a light-emitting face, the main body defining an optical axis that extends through the centers of the light-collecting face and the light-emitting face;

a pocket in the main body defined by the light-collecting face for receiving light from the light source, the pocket being defined by an inner axially-facing surface surrounded by an inner radially-facing surface, the pocket having an open end, the inner axially-facing surface being concave and having a spherical shape;

the inner radially-facing surface having a conical shape and extending between the inner axially-facing surface and the open end of the pocket;

wherein the light-emitting face comprises a central section and an outer section, the outer section radially surrounding the central section and having a conical shape;

wherein the outer section generally defines a concave conical surface and is configured to direct light rays toward the optical axis.

2. A lens for use with a light emitting source, the lens comprising:

a main body having a light-collecting face and a light-emitting face, the main body defining an optical axis that extends through the centers of the light-collecting face and the light-emitting face;

a pocket in the main body defined by the light-collecting face for receiving light from the light source, the pocket being defined by an inner axially-facing surface surrounded by an inner radially-facing surface, the pocket having an open end, the inner axially-facing surface being concave and having a spherical shape;

the inner radially-facing surface having a conical shape and extending between the inner axially-facing surface and the open end of the pocket.

3. The lens of claim 2 , wherein the light-emitting face comprises a central section and an outer section, the outer section radially surrounding the central section and having a conical shape.

4. The lens of claim 3 , wherein the central section is dome shaped.

5. The lens of claim 3 , further comprising a connector radially supporting the lens.

6. The lens of claim 3 , wherein the lens has an effective outer diameter in the range of about five to twenty millimeters.

7. The lens of claim 3 , wherein the lens has an effective outer diameter in the range of about five to ten millimeters.

8. lens of claim 2 , wherein the light-emitting source is a light-emitting diode.

9. A light assembly comprising:

a lens having:

a main body with a light-collecting face and a light-emitting face, and defining an optical axis that extends through the centers of the light-collecting face and the light-emitting face;

a pocket formed in the light-collecting face, the pocket having an open end and being defined by an inner axially-facing surface surrounded by an inner radially-facing surface, the inner axially-facing surface being generally concave and having a hemispherical shape, the inner radially-facing surface having a conical shape and extending between the axially-facing surface and the open end of the pocket; and

a light-emitting diode as a light source, the light-emitting diode having a dome-shaped surface optic being generally disposed within the pocket of the lens.

10. The light assembly of claim 9 , wherein the light-emitting face of the lens comprises a central section and an outer section, the outer section radially surrounding the central section and having a conical shape.

11. The light assembly of claim 10 , wherein the outer section is configured to direct light rays toward the optical axis.

12. The light assembly of claim 10 , wherein the central section has a dome shape.

13. The light assembly of claim 10 , further comprising a connector supporting the lens and being configured to connect the lens to a circuit board.

14. The light assembly of claim 10 , wherein the lens has an outer diameter in the range of about five to about twenty millimeters.

15. The light assembly of claim 10 , wherein the outer diameter is in the range of about five to about ten millimeters.

16. The light assembly of claim 9 , wherein a portion of the dome-shaped surface optic of the light-emitting diode is positioned in the range of about 0.5 to about 2 millimeters from the inner axially-facing surface of the light-collecting face.

17. The light assembly of claim 16 , wherein a portion of the dome-shaped surface optic of the light-emitting diode is positioned in the range of about 0.5 to about 2 millimeters from the inner radially-facing surface of the light-collecting face.

18. The light assembly of claim 9 , further comprising a cylindrical tube having a first end attached to the lens, the cylindrical tube being configured to extend between the lens and a light pipe.

19. The light assembly of claim 18 , wherein the cylindrical tube has a reflective inner surface.
